How much equipment did the US give Russia in ww2?

By the end of June 1944 the United States had sent to the Soviets under lend-lease more than 11,000 planes; over 6,000 tanks and tank destroyers; and 300,000 trucks and other military vehicles.

Is Russia running out of ammunition

In November Lloyd Austin, America’s defence secretary, spoke of “significant shortages”. At a briefing on December 12th a senior American defence official said that, at current rates of use, Russia could sustain “fully serviceable” tube and rocket artillery ammunition only until early 2023.

How many T 90 tanks does Russia have

Russian arms firm Uralvagonzavod has manufactured around 600 T-90 tanks for the Russian army. The 45-ton, three-person T-90 with its 125-millimter gun and steel-composite armor is Russia’s best tank.

Did Russia ever pay back lend-lease

Similarly, the Soviet Union repaid $722 million in 1971, with the remainder of the debt written off. Reverse Lend-Lease to the United States totalled $7.8 billion.

Who supplied the Soviets in WW2

Totaling $11.3 billion, or $180 billion in today’s currency, the Lend-Lease Act of the United States supplied needed goods to the Soviet Union from 19 in support of what Stalin described to Roosevelt as the “enormous and difficult fight against the common enemy — bloodthirsty Hitlerism.”

Did US supply weapons to Russia in WW2

Roughly 17.5 million tons of military equipment, vehicles, industrial supplies, and food were shipped from the Western Hemisphere to the USSR, 94% coming from the US. For comparison, a total of 22 million tons landed in Europe to supply American forces from January 1942 to May 1945.

How strong was the Russian army in WW2?

By war’s end the Soviet armed forces numbered 11,365,000 officers and men. Demobilization, however, started toward the end of 1945, and in a few years the armed forces fell to fewer than 3,000,000 troops.

How many t 72 does Russia have

In theory Russia has thousands of tanks waiting in giant warehouses and vehicles parks which can be reactivated. According to the Military Balance 2021, quoted in Kyiv Independent, Russia has over 10,000 battle tanks in storage, mainly T-72s and T-80s.

Who makes ammunition for Russia

JSC Ulyanovsk Cartridge Works

The only Russian manufacturer of 14.5mm ammunition for various purposes. The distinctive feature of the works is availability of pyrotechnical workshops, technologies and equipment for producing tracer, incendiary and explosive bullets of instantaneous action.

How much of US ammo comes from Russia

Russia has been by far the largest supplier of imported rounds to the USA and by some industry estimates has provided up to 10% of all ammunition here. Americans buy roughly 10 billion rounds of ammunition annually, according to the NSSF.

How many T 64 tanks does Ukraine have

Redesignated as the T-64BM2 Bulat, 10 of these tanks would be deployed into combat, defending Kharkiv as part of the 72nd and 92nd Mechanized Brigades. By the eve of Putin’s 2022 invasion, the Ukrainian military had roughly 850 T-64s in service, including around 100 in its National Guard and Marine Corps.

Does Russia still have T 55 tanks

Since the beginning of 1980, they began to be replaced by modern T-62 and T-64 tanks. The T-62 and the T-55 were auctioned off in 2012, with all Russian active-duty military units mainly operating the T-72, the T-80 and the T-90. However, T-62s were spotted in Melitopol in the 2022 Ukraine War.
